> On 8/4/26 9:57 PM, Praveen Talari wrote:
>> On the SA8255P platform there is no Linux clock handler for the SE source
>> clock; resources are instead managed by firmware via a genpd performance
>> domain. The I2C driver therefore relies on geni_se_set_rate() to apply the
>> fixed 19.2 MHz source clock frequency expected by the SCL divider and
>> counter values programmed by qcom_geni_i2c_conf().

Yes, it was not there earlier. I have added because of Fast-mode Plus (1 
MHz)

cannot achieve the required timings with the default 19.2 MHz source clock.

A higher source frequency (for example, 32.5 MHz or 37.5 MHz) is required,

along with the associated voltage/performance vote.
